#EB6750 Hex Color Code

#EB6750

The Hexadecimal Color #EB6750 is a contrast shade of Tomato. #EB6750 RGB value is rgb(235, 103, 80). RGB Color Model of #EB6750 consists of 92% red, 40% green and 31% blue. HSL color Mode of #EB6750 has 9°(degrees) Hue, 79% Saturation and 62% Lightness. #EB6750 color has an wavelength of 614.33333n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#EB6750 is #FF9966.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#EB6750 is #E65. The Closest Color to #EB6750 is #FF6347. Official Name of #EB6750 Hex Code is Burnt Sienna.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#EB6750 is 0 Cyan 56 Magenta 66 Yellow 8 Black and #EB6750 CMY is 0, 56, 66.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#EB6750 is hsl(9,79,62,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(9, 66, 92).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#EB6750 is 40.56, 27.95, 10.85.
Hex8 Value of #EB6750 is #EB6750FF. Decimal Value of #EB6750 is 15427408 and Octal Value of #EB6750 is 72663520. Binary Value of #EB6750 is 11101011, 1100111, 1010000 and Android of #EB6750 is 4293617488 / 0xffeb6750.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#EB6750 is 0.511, 0.352, 0.352 and YIQ Color Space of #EB6750 is 139.846, 86.0487, 20.7604.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#EB6750 is 39.97, 18.97, 11.17.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#EB6750 is 59.84, 49.52, 38.04.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#EB6750 is 59.84, 102.44, 33.11.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#EB6750 is 59.84, 62.44, 37.53. Hunter Lab variable of #EB6750 is 52.87, 44.43, 24.84.

Various Color Shades of #EB6750

To get 25% Saturated #EB6750 Color, you need to convert the hex color #EB6750 to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#EB6750 h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#EB6750

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
